The Facts about Skin Cancer
Skin cancer is on the rise in the United States with at least 1 million new cases diagnosed annually. Because one in five Americans will be diagnosed with skin cancer over their lifetime, it is important for all of us to be able to identify the warning signs. Any mole or growth with change in size, shape, color, or behavior is an important screening tool for the identification of a malignant lesion. Irregular borders, asymmetry, and non-uniform color are other important features to watch out for.
Basal cell carcinoma and squamous cell carcinoma account for the majority of skin cancers in the United States. Over 70% of skin cancers are basal cell carcinomas, which are a slow growing cancer rarely spreading to the body. Squamous cell carcinoma comprises about 20% of all skin cancers and has only a slightly higher incidence of metastasis than basal cell carcinoma. For both skin cancers, early detection minimizes risk of invasion and destruction of nearby tissue. Skin cancers are typically seen in persons with heavy sun exposure or those who have had multiple sunburns. Individuals even in their 20s are now being diagnosed with skin cancer so everyone needs to protect their skin and monitor for suspicious lesions.
Melanoma is one of the most deadly forms of skin cancer and its incidence is on the rise in the United States. Persons at increased risk of developing melanoma include individuals with many moles, a history of heavy sun exposure or tanning bed exposure, and a family history of melanoma. Melanoma can impact a person of any age. It can also develop in areas where there has been little to no sun exposure such as the bottom of a foot. Although the first sign of melanoma is often a change in the size, shape, or color of an existing mole, melanoma can also appear on the body as a brand new lesion.
